Subject: Rotation notice — Tollgate idempotency service

For your review: we have rotated the credential used by the Tollgate retry layer, which deduplicates payment retries via idempotency keys. No key material was exposed; this is routine quarterly hygiene. Retry semantics and key TTLs are unchanged. For verification against the sandbox endpoint, the new key follows below.

gateway credential: kto23_dolYgAScEh2TaPOlStqOl98

To: Executive Team
Cc: Branch Managers
Subject: FY Headcount Plan

Headcount next year: net +4%. Growth concentrated in Westrow and Pellam branches; Harlan Cove holds flat. Backfills require VP sign-off through Q2. Contractor conversions capped at twelve. Final numbers lock after board review. The confidential business-plan note follows immediately below.

internal memo for yahaf-hawif: The finance team signed off on a budget of $59.9 million for Project Rusax.

During the Glimmerpane incident, a regression in the date-picker shipped because snapshot tests had been disabled for three sprints after a flaky renderer upgrade. Future maintainers: re-enable snapshots in CI as blocking, regenerate baselines against the pinned renderer version, and add the quarterly baseline-review task to the team rotation. Do not mark snapshots as skip without an expiry date attached. The snapshot workflow, baseline update procedure, and flake triage guide are documented on the internal page below.

wiki page, tahaf-tajog: https://jira.ordindyn.corp/pipeline

Subject: Cron jobs migrated to Larkspur

Team — the remaining report and cleanup cron jobs on the Pellin hosts were cut over to the Larkspur workflow engine this morning. Schedules are unchanged; retries and alerting now come from Larkspur itself. Old crontabs are disabled but not deleted until next cycle. The migration shipped under the build identified directly below.

pipeline stamp: htk9_ce63042d9